what on earth is Magnetic Flux Leakage screening and So how exactly does It operate?
Magnetic Flux Leakage screening is a complicated non-destructive screening approach applied largely for identifying defects in ferromagnetic materials like steel pipes and tubes. the method consists of magnetizing the material to make a magnetic subject within it. whenever a defect, for instance a crack or corrosion, disrupts the magnetic field, it will cause a lot of the magnetic flux to "leak" away from the material. These leakages are then detected by superior-sensitivity sensors connected to the tests tools. The captured knowledge permits inspectors to pinpoint The placement, size, and mother nature of your defect. MFL screening is particularly successful in industries that deal with pipelines, steel plates, and bars where by the standard of elements is important for protection and operational trustworthiness. By leveraging this engineering, companies can detect possible challenges prior to they evolve into high-priced failures, keeping compliance with basic safety expectations.
